One of the things Twitter is used for beyond socializing and marketing is for emergencies. In one of the articles, people in Houston during hurricane Harvey were trying to survive the floods but couldn’t get in contact with emergency crews via 911. Instead, some people took to Twitter, posting that they needed help and including their addresses in the tweet in case someone would see it and somehow help. Another example of Twitter being used in emergencies is during the Boston bombing in 2013. After the bombing happened people who were at the event put their opinions that looked like facts on Twitter. This made it hard for the news and the investigators. Neither one knew fact from fiction based on the tweets of people claiming they know what happened.

One event that happened in 2018 was March For Our Lives. This was a student-led movement about gun control in America. The movement demanded change in a lot of aspects of how the laws of guns are handled. It is way too easy to get a hold of a gun in the US and this movement was trying to change that. This event also happened a month after the school shooting in Parkland, Florida where a former student opened fire which killed 17 students and injured 17 others. According to Wikipedia, this school shooting surpassed the Columbine shooting in 1999, which killed 15, as the deadliest school shooting in the US.
One event that happened in 2017, 2018, and still happening in 2019 is the #MeToo movement. This movement acknowledges the sexual abuse and sexual harassment many people have been through. The hashtag grew popularity in 2017 when actress Alyssa Milano asked people on Twitter to respond to her tweet about sexual assault with #MeToo to show just how prevalent it is around the world. This tweet lead to many celebrities coming forward about their stories.
Finally, the third event that has happened is regarding climate change. In September of 2019 there were climate strikes across the world between the 20th and 27th. This week was chosen because of the United Nations Climate Summit on the 23rd. Many people participated in the strikes around the world including Greta Thunberg, who has become an inspiration to many people at sixteen years old.
